DFIR

Investigate security incidents by analyzing event logs, network captures, and filesystem artifacts. Detect and reconstruct AD attack chains.

Techniques

DomainKey Capabilities
Windows Event LogsEVTX parsing, Event ID correlation, logon tracking, privilege enumeration
Network ForensicsPCAP analysis, NTLM extraction, LLMNR/NBT-NS poisoning detection, relay identification
Filesystem ForensicsMFT parsing, Prefetch analysis, VSS artifact recovery, Linux persistence, timeline reconstruction
AD Attack DetectionKerberoasting, AS-REP roasting, NTDS dump, NTLM relay, credential theft
Memory ForensicsVolatility3 analysis: process trees, file extraction, SID resolution, command lines
